Kitchen and Dining: A Taste of Greenery
Elevate your kitchen and dining areas with the fresh appeal of leaf design wallpaper! This is a fantastic way to add personality and style to spaces often dominated by functional elements. In the kitchen, consider a subtle, easy-to-clean vinyl leaf wallpaper for a backsplash area or an accent wall. Patterns with smaller, more spaced-out leaves in cheerful colors like light green, yellow, or even a subtle blue can make the space feel brighter and more inviting. Think about a pattern that mimics the look of herbs or simple foliage – it adds a touch of natural charm without being overpowering. For dining rooms, you have a bit more freedom to be dramatic. A lush, deep green tropical leaf wallpaper can create a sophisticated and intimate atmosphere, perfect for dinner parties. Imagine the conversation it would spark! Pair it with elegant tableware and perhaps a statement light fixture. Alternatively, a vintage botanical print featuring a variety of leaves and maybe even some subtle floral elements can add a touch of old-world charm and character. Metallic leaf accents can also work beautifully in a dining room, adding a subtle shimmer and a hint of luxury. When selecting wallpaper for these areas, especially the kitchen, remember to consider durability and ease of cleaning. Vinyl or washable wallpapers are excellent choices as they can withstand moisture and are easier to wipe down. The goal is to infuse these practical spaces with style and a connection to nature, making meal times and cooking experiences more enjoyable and visually appealing. Bathroom Bliss with Botanical Prints
Transform your bathroom into a spa-like oasis with the refreshing touch of leaf design wallpaper. Bathrooms, especially powder rooms, are perfect spaces to experiment with bolder or more whimsical patterns. Consider a vibrant tropical leaf wallpaper to create a fun, exotic feel – it’s like a mini-vacation every time you step inside! Think lush greens, bright blues, or even pops of pink and orange. This works wonderfully as a full-room application or on an accent wall. For a more serene, spa-like ambiance, opt for a muted botanical print with delicate fern fronds, eucalyptus leaves, or subtle bamboo stalks. These patterns bring a sense of calm and natural elegance, turning your bathroom into a peaceful sanctuary for unwinding. Water-resistant or vinyl wallpapers are ideal for bathrooms due to the increased humidity. Look for patterns with darker backgrounds, like deep teal or forest green, which can make a small bathroom feel more intimate and sophisticated. White or light-colored leaf patterns, on the other hand, can make a small bathroom feel more spacious and airy. Don't be afraid to play with scale; even a small powder room can handle a larger, more dramatic leaf motif if used strategically, perhaps on just one wall. Consider pairing your leaf wallpaper with natural materials like wood, stone, or rattan accents to enhance the connection to nature. Plants, of course, are always a welcome addition! Choosing the Right Scale
This is HUGE, guys! The scale of the leaf pattern is super important for how the wallpaper will look and feel in your room. Think about the size of your space and the overall vibe you're going for. In a small bathroom or a cozy powder room, a huge, oversized leaf print might feel overwhelming and make the room seem even smaller. Instead, opt for a smaller, more delicate leaf pattern or use a bold print on just one accent wall. For larger living rooms or bedrooms, you have more freedom. Large-scale tropical leaves can make a grand statement and feel really luxurious. If you have a lot of furniture and decor, a smaller, more intricate pattern might get lost, so a bolder scale can actually help the wallpaper stand out. Always try to get a sample of the wallpaper and hold it up in the room you plan to decorate. Look at it at different times of the day to see how the light affects it. This will give you a much better sense of how the scale will work in your specific space. Remember, the right scale can make or break the look, so choose wisely!
Color Palette Coordination
When you're picking out your leaf design wallpaper, make sure the colors work with your existing decor. This is key to creating a cohesive and stylish look. If your room has a lot of neutral furniture, you can go wild with a vibrant green or multi-colored leaf pattern. The wallpaper can be the main pop of color! If your room already has a strong color scheme, choose a leaf wallpaper that picks up on one or two of those existing colors, or opt for a more subtle, tone-on-tone pattern. For example, if you have navy blue accents, a navy and white leaf print or an emerald green leaf pattern would tie things together beautifully. Don't forget to consider the undertones of your colors – warm woods pair well with warmer greens, while cool grays might look better with bluer greens. Look at the colors in your furniture, rugs, curtains, and artwork. The wallpaper should complement these elements, not clash with them. Sometimes, just pulling one small accent color from your existing decor and finding a wallpaper that features it can make all the difference. It’s all about creating harmony and ensuring your new leafy walls feel like a natural extension of your room’s overall design, rather than an afterthought. A well-coordinated color palette ensures your chosen wallpaper truly enhances the space, making it feel intentionally designed and beautifully balanced.
